King tides in Maryland, 2026
The biggest predicted tide in Maryland in 2026 reaches 3.9 ft above MLLW at Bladensburg, Md. on Monday, May 18, at 10:09 AMlocal time. Below are all of the year's king tide windows — the top 1% of predicted highs — for NOAA reference stations along the Marylandcoast. King tides are perigean spring tides: they arrive when a full or new moon lines up with the moon's closest approach to Earth, and they preview the flooding that sea level rise will make routine. NOAA CO-OPS harmonic predictions, datum MLLW, station local time. Actual water level can run higher with storms, onshore wind, and low pressure — king tide + storm is the flooding combination to watch. Predictions are for planning, not navigation.
